Whorl Ltd develops a focused line of e-commerce and server products, primarily jShop and jShop Server, with a vulnerability profile centered on application-layer input-handling flaws such as path traversal and SQL injection. | CVE | Published | CVSS | Risk | KEV | Exploit |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
CVE-2009-3835HIGH SQL injection vulnerability in the JShop (com_jshop) component for Joomla! all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ary SQL commands via the pid parameter in a product action to in | Nov 2, 2009 | 7.5 | 30 | NO | YES |
CVE-2008-1624HIGH Directory traversal vulnerability in v2demo/page.php in Jshop Server 1.x through 2.x allows remote attackers to include and execute arbitrary local files via a .. (dot dot) in the | Apr 2, 2008 | 7.5 | 29 | NO | YES |
